VP Leni Robredo goes on self-quarantine again after close-in security tests positive for COVID-19

 

 

The camp of Vice President Maria Leonor “Leni” Robredo announced that she will undergo a self-quarantine for the second time after a member of her close-in security team tested positive for COVID-19.

It might be remembered that the Vice President has already undergone a precautionary self quarantine last October 2020 when a member of her close staff also tested positive for COVID-19.

Robredo was supposed to leave for her home province in Bicol (April 17) when she was informed that a member of her close-in security tested positive for COVID-19. She did not contract the virus then.

(photo credit to owner)


“I was all set to go. But just a few minutes ago, I received a contact tracing call informing me that my close-in security has tested positive,” she said.

VP Robredo said she was a close contact of her close-in security since they’re together the entire week.

“I was with him in the car, in the elevator, and in the office almost everyday this week. We have regular surveillance antigen testing in the office and we do follow very strict health protocols but because I was a very close contact, I need to do the required quarantine and do an rt-pcr test after my quarantine,” she explained.
